编程课学期计划怎么写

时间:2025-01-23 06:14:49 游戏攻略

编写编程课学期计划时,可以按照以下步骤进行:

确定学习目标

明确学习编程的目的,例如提升技能、准备就业或开发项目。

设定短期和长期的学习目标,确保每个阶段都有明确的目标。

选择编程语言和工具

根据学习目标和兴趣选择合适的编程语言,如Python、Java、C++等。

选择适合的学习工具和平台,例如IDE、在线课程、编程社区等。

制定学习周期

根据所选编程语言、教程和个人时间安排,制定详细的学习计划。

安排每周或每天的学习时间,保持学习的连续性和规律性。

设置学习内容和项目实践

将学习内容分为基础语法、数据结构、算法、项目实践等模块。

在每个阶段安排具体的学习任务,如完成一定数量的练习题或开发一个小项目。

实践导向的学习

通过实际项目开发,将所学知识应用于实际问题中,提高解决问题的能力。

在学习过程中,不断进行代码练习和代码审查,确保代码质量。

定期复习和总结

定期回顾所学内容,巩固知识点。

总结学习经验和遇到的问题,及时调整学习计划和方法。

利用在线资源

利用免费的在线教程和课程,如Codecademy、Udemy等,丰富学习资源。

参与编程社区和论坛,与其他学习者交流经验和解决问题。

监督和激励

家长或监护人监督孩子的学习进度,确保学习计划的执行。

设定奖励机制,激励自己坚持完成学习任务。

第1-2周:学习Python基础语法,包括变量、数据类型、控制流语句等。

第3-4周:学习Python高级特性,如函数、模块、文件操作等。

第5-6周:学习基本数据结构,如列表、元组、字典、集合等。

第7-8周:学习基本算法,如排序、查找、递归等,并通过在线编程平台进行练习。

第9-10周:进行一个小项目开发,如简单的Web应用或数据分析报告。

第11-12周:学习面向对象编程,包括类、对象、继承、多态等,并用Python实现一个小型项目。

第13-14周:复习和总结前面学到的知识点,准备期中考试或项目展示。

第15-16周:进行期末项目开发,综合运用所学知识完成一个综合性项目。

通过以上步骤和示例,可以制定出一个详细且实用的编程课学期计划。